METHOD AND APPARATUS FOR ADVANCED CABAC CONTEXT ADAPTATION FOR LAST COEFFICIENT CODING
Coding of the last coded coefficient position is performed by basing the coding of they coordinate of the position of the last coded coefficient on the x coordinate value of the last coded coefficient. This enables the context adaptive coding of the last coded coefficient parameter much more efficient. In an embodiment, a partial transform is used to code a block of image values. The partial transform enables further efficiencies in coding of the last coded coefficient.
1 . A method for coding a block of transformed coefficients, comprising:
transforming a block of image values to obtain transformed coefficients;
entropy coding two coordinates defining a position in the block of a last non-zero transformed coefficient determined by a scanning of the transformed coefficients,
wherein the entropy coding of one coordinate (y) of said two coordinates depends on the value of the other coordinate (x).
2 . The method of claim 1 , wherein entropy coding said one coordinate (y) uses contexts which depend on the other coordinate (x).
3 . The method of any preceding claim, further comprising:
splitting each of the two coordinates up into a prefix and a suffix; and,
inferring the value of the prefix of the y coordinate from the x coordinate.
4 . The method of any preceding claim, wherein an adaptive set of orthogonal transforms include a partial transform used to transform the block of image values.
